Here is what I have to help identify these folks:
#1. Henry Campbell b. 1706 Scotland, d. 1772 Amherst Co VA. This man lived
in an area which is now called Nelson Co VA
Married to Charity.
Their son was Ambrose Campbell, who married Margaret. His wife's name is
confirmed as Margaret by his Will. Ambrose was born 1740 in Scotland and
died 1811. He was a Revolutionary War Vet.
Therefor, it must be his daughter named Frances Campbell who married George
Ennis.
I would make a wild guess that it was her SISTER? who married George's
brother?? Can anyone confirm this wild guess?
Apparently, George Ennis and Frances Campbell had a daughter named Frances
Ennis, and she married John Sale Campbell.
I happen to know that John Sale Campbell was the son of Wiley Campbell and
Elizabeth M. Sale. Wiley Campbell was son of Joel, s/o Henry and Charity.
Therefore Ambrose and Joel Campbell were brothers, the grandson of Joel
Campbell married the granddaughter of Ambrose Campbell.
This family line involves the descendants of Henry Campbell and his wife
Charity. This couple are immigrants from Scotland, as they were already
married abroad.
